Nursing School Entrance Exam
If you are taking the NET, it is only reading comprehension and basic math. I was scared to death, because I knew you had to not only pass but do really well to get into my nursing school. I bought the study guide for the NET, and I did great on the NET. I am also accepted to start my BSN in January. Like someone else said, different schools use different tests, so make really sure which one they are using. Another program here used a different entrance test that did have science on it. But with that said, buy the study book with the NET if your nursing school is using that test, and it will help lots.
